I needed something that lets me organize tasks and notes in a tree like manner, like Workflowy, but with proper documents and more text editing functionality, like Evernote, so I built it myself: https://flownote.io
Note taking and sketching software that aims to be as easy to use as a paper notebook, with the benefit that you can have a hierarchy of notebooks and you can share, search and export your notes. That's what makes it cool. It also has markdown support and a really clean user interface.

Evernote and Google Docs are both great, but their interfaces are too cluttered for me and using them simply doesn't come close to using a good paper notebook. It just isn't as delightful. A physical notebook has its own drawbacks however (don't want to carry another item around with me, it's difficult to organize it into different sections, etc.), so I knew I had to create a software solution. That's my vision for Flownote.
